Robert Kocharyan blocked from leaving Armenia

Security officials at Zvartnots Airport have prevented Armenia’s second president Robert Kocharyan from leaving the country.

Axar.az reports, citing Armenian media, that Kocharyan was not allowed to exit Armenia.

It is noted that the office of the former president had previously announced that Kocharyan had left the country on a three-day trip, describing it as a private visit that had been planned for a long time and postponed due to a busy pre-election schedule.

Earlier, after the elections on June 9, Prosperous Armenia Party leader Gagik Tsarukyan also attempted to leave Yerevan but was reportedly turned back at Zvartnots Airport.
